Decoding Emotions: AI's Journey into the Realm of Feeling
The realm of human emotions has long been a enigma for researchers. Traditionally, understanding feelings relied on subjective interpretations and complex psychological analysis. But now, artificial intelligence (AI) is venturing on a remarkable journey to interpret these abstract states.
Novel AI algorithms are utilized to process vast archives of human interactions, hunting for trends that correspond with specific emotions. Through machine learning, these AI click here models are acquiring to distinguish subtle cues in facial expressions, voice tone, and even textual communication.
- Eventually, this revolutionary technology has the possibility to transform the way we understand emotions, offering valuable insights in fields such as healthcare, teaching, and even customer service.
The Human Touch: Where AI Falls Short in Emotional Intelligence
While artificial intelligence advances at a staggering pace, there remains a crucial area where it falls short: emotional intelligence. AI algorithms can't to truly grasp the complexities of human sentiment. They lack the capacity for empathy, compassion, and intuition that are vital for navigating social situations. AI may be able to analyze facial expressions and pitch in voice, but it lacks the ability to truly feel what lies beneath the surface. This core difference highlights the enduring value of human connection and the irreplaceable part that emotions have in shaping our lives.
